During the 2020-2021 academic year, University of Phoenix - Arizona handed out 346 bachelor's degrees in community organization & advocacy. This is an increase of 30% over the previous year when 266 degrees were handed out.

How Much Do Community Organization Graduates from UOPX - Arizona Make?

$38,488 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of Community Organization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

Community Organization majors who earn their bachelor's degree from UOPX - Arizona go on to jobs where they make a median salary of $38,488 a year. This is higher than $32,311, which is the national median for all community organization bachelor's degree recipients.

How Much Student Debt Do Community Organization Graduates from UOPX - Arizona Have?

$50,765 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Community Organization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

While getting their bachelor's degree at UOPX - Arizona, community organization students borrow a median amount of $50,765 in student loans. This is higher than the the typical median of $31,047 for all community organization majors across the country.

UOPX - Arizona Community Organization & Advocacy Bachelor’s Program

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 346 community organization majors earned their bachelor's degree from UOPX - Arizona. Of these graduates, 14% were men and 86% were women.
